Last weekend Mark got a virus (a Botnet really) on his computer and he's really just now getting it back to "normal" after reformatting and losing most all of the stuff saved on it. He and I share a network, so for the fear of it creeping over to my computer, I've had to leave mine off. The botnet apparently came in via a worm virus. If you get an e-mail (even if it's from a friend) about a UFO at the inauguration (videos attached to it), DON'T OPEN IT!!! This thing was the weirdest thing I've ever seen. It was moving his files, hiding files and deleting files. The worst it got was when the computer would restart, then about 2 minutes later, it would turn itself off...this went on for a while as he attempted to get it fixed. Earlier in the week, when he was finally able to access his e-mail account, he received a notice from our internet company that his internet service was shut down. He called, as the notice instructed, and found out that during the time he was working on his computer, for about a 3 or 4 hour period, that his server sent out over 800,000 (yes you are reading that number correctly) spam e-mails. Luckily the internet service people recognized what it was and gave him a little more info on it, so he was able to better find programs that would help him get it fixed.
